void ChatTab::chatInput(const std::string &message)
{
    std::string msg = message;
    trim(msg);

    if (msg.empty())
        return;

    replaceItemLinks(msg);
    replaceVars(msg);

    switch (msg[0])
    {
        case '/':
            handleCommandStr(std::string(msg, 1));
            break;
        case '?':
            if (msg.size() > 1 &&
                msg[1] != '!' &&
                msg[1] != '?' &&
                msg[1] != '.' &&
                msg[1] != ' ' &&
                msg[1] != ',')
            {
                handleHelp(std::string(msg, 1));
            }
            else
            {
                handleInput(msg);
            }
            break;
        default:
            handleInput(msg);
            break;
    }
}

static void loadQuest(const int var,
                      XmlNodeConstPtr node)
{
    if (node == nullptr)
        return;
    QuestItem *const quest = new QuestItem;
    // TRANSLATORS: quests window quest name
    quest->name = XML::langProperty(node, "name", _("unknown"));
    quest->group = XML::getProperty(node, "group", "");
    std::string incompleteStr = XML::getProperty(node, "incomplete", "");
    std::string completeStr = XML::getProperty(node, "complete", "");
    if (incompleteStr.empty() && completeStr.empty())
    {
        logger->log("complete flags incorrect");
        delete quest;
        return;
    }
    splitToIntSet(quest->incomplete, incompleteStr, ',');
    splitToIntSet(quest->complete, completeStr, ',');
    if (quest->incomplete.empty() && quest->complete.empty())
    {
        logger->log("complete flags incorrect");
        delete quest;
        return;
    }
    if (quest->incomplete.empty() || quest->complete.empty())
        quest->broken = true;

    for_each_xml_child_node(dataNode, node)
    {
        if (!xmlTypeEqual(dataNode, XML_ELEMENT_NODE))
            continue;
        XmlChar *const data = reinterpret_cast<XmlChar*>(
            XmlNodeGetContent(dataNode));
        if (data == nullptr)
            continue;
        std::string str = translator->getStr(data);
        XmlFree(data);

        for (int f = 1; f < 100; f ++)
        {
            const std::string key = strprintf("text%d", f);
            const std::string val = XML::getProperty(dataNode,
                key.c_str(),
                "");
            if (val.empty())
                break;
            const std::string param = strprintf("{@@%d}", f);
            replaceAll(str, param, val);
        }
        replaceItemLinks(str);
        if (xmlNameEqual(dataNode, "text"))
        {
            quest->texts.push_back(QuestItemText(str,
                QuestType::TEXT,
                std::string(),
                std::string()));
        }
        else if (xmlNameEqual(dataNode, "name"))
        {
            quest->texts.push_back(QuestItemText(str,
                QuestType::NAME,
                std::string(),
                std::string()));
        }
        else if (xmlNameEqual(dataNode, "reward"))
        {
            quest->texts.push_back(QuestItemText(str,
                QuestType::REWARD,
                std::string(),
                std::string()));
        }
        else if (xmlNameEqual(dataNode, "questgiver") ||
                 xmlNameEqual(dataNode, "giver"))
        {
            quest->texts.push_back(QuestItemText(str,
                QuestType::GIVER,
                std::string(),
                std::string()));
        }
        else if (xmlNameEqual(dataNode, "coordinates"))
        {
            const std::string str1 = toString(XML::getIntProperty(
                dataNode, "x", 0, 1, 1000));
            const std::string str2 = toString(XML::getIntProperty(
                dataNode, "y", 0, 1, 1000));
            quest->texts.push_back(QuestItemText(str,
                QuestType::COORDINATES,
                str1,
                str2));
        }
        else if (xmlNameEqual(dataNode, "npc"))
        {
            quest->texts.push_back(QuestItemText(str,
                QuestType::NPC,
                std::string(),
                std::string()));
        }
    }
    quest->var = var;
    mQuests[var].push_back(quest);
}
